The role of Caretaker is extremely varied; however, the main purpose is to ensure our school is presented and maintained to an excellent standard. With a focus on cleaning and maintenance, you will be responsible for weekly schedules, covering areas in the nursery, school, pool area and school vehicles. In addition to these responsibilities, you will need to have a flexible approach to help with a variety of other tasks
- these can include, but are not limited to general maintenance, decorating, driving our children to events, picking up supplies for the Estates team and supporting the wider team with jobs that arise. Due to the nature of the role, a degree of physical fitness is required.

**1. OVERVIEW**
The responsibilities of the role are varied and will include cleaning and maintaining excellent standards within the school. This includes cleaning of our offices within our main manor house as well as covering for cleaners within school holidays. You will provide general support to the estates team to carry out various tasks that may include general maintenance, Health and Safety checks, security, and driving. This role provides a great first step into an Estates career and would be ideally suited to someone who is passionate about standards. We are looking for someone who is proactive and positive. We have a very experienced and skilled Estates team and there are plenty of opportunities to work alongside the team to learn new skills.
**2. TERMS SPECIFIC TO THE ROLE**
The hours will be 40 hours per week, Monday to Friday (10am-6.30pm). Occasional weekends and evening security may be required and time off in lieu will be given for this. These hours may vary during holiday weeks.
You will be enrolled into the school’s support staff pension scheme and will be entitled to lunches (weekdays) and tea/coffee throughout the school day. Use of the school’s facilities, including the swimming pool are on offer where available.
